In one of many UK’s wealthiest boroughs, 1,000 Christmas introduction calendars sit ready alongside a mountain of nappies, child components and garments to be given to households in want.
What began as a kitchen desk undertaking run by two Windsor moms has grown into an impartial charity that helps 1000’s of households every year.
From supplying components and garments to child buggies and nappies, the Baby Bank – now located down the street in Maidenhead, Berkshire – has an awesome quantity of inventory that’s sorted by means of by volunteers.
And within the run-up to a Christmas blighted by a price of dwelling disaster, demand is hovering.
Rebecca Mistry, co-founder and co-chief govt, started the undertaking when her personal daughter was two – she’s now ten, and in that point the charity has moved a number of occasions as they proceed to outgrow their premises.
“We just thought, if people need food banks they also probably need help specific to babies,” Ms Mistry instructed Sky News.
Since opening their doorways, the Baby Bank has expanded its attain and now helps youngsters as much as the age of 16.
Ms Mistry works alongside Lauren Hall, her fellow chief govt, and a workforce of volunteers.
In 2019, the Baby Bank helped 1,600 households. A 12 months later, through the COVID pandemic, this greater than doubled to three,262.
So far this 12 months, it has had referrals for greater than 4,123 households.
Pleas by means of the door
Pleas for assist come by means of the door by the way in which of well being guests and social employees – and as quickly as it’s unlocked, Ms Mistry doesn’t cease shifting.
She packs referral baggage, takes the donation of a buggy and cot, and solutions cellphone name after cellphone name asking for assist.
One name nonetheless sticks in her thoughts.
“I answered the phone one day, and a woman was just sobbing,” she stated.
“I asked what I could do, and she said ‘I don’t need help’. She was calling to thank us.
“She had escaped an abusive relationship and she or he stated, ‘I am unable to get my daughter to take off your garments. She is simply dancing round in them.'”
As Ms Mistry kinds by means of a clothes referral for a two-year-old, she has exacting requirements.
Anything with a mark, or gap, is put to at least one facet. If she would not put her personal youngsters in it, she will not give it to anybody else in want.
The garments are then neatly packed in a nondescript bag for all times.
“We don’t want to make things worse for anyone,” she stated.
“So we don’t put our logo on anything – we don’t want them to feel embarrassed if they are out with their friends who spot one of our donation bags.”
Debt and imminent homelessness
As the group focus on the current demise of Awaab Ishak, a toddler who died as a direct results of black mould within the flat his dad and mom rented, one well being customer stated a household she works with has “water running down the walls”.
Others are 1000’s of kilos in debt and going through imminent homelessness.
Beyond the necessities – together with each branded and generic faculty uniform – the Baby Bank tries to convey youngsters within the space just a little little bit of Christmas magic.
Its Christmas marketing campaign encourages locals to drop off a present bag containing a pair of brand-new pyjamas and a e-book.
Volunteers then add one of many 1,000 introduction calendars, donated by a neighborhood enterprise.
Radiators turned off
But the charity itself will not be resistant to the price of dwelling disaster – not one of the radiators within the unit is switched on, and when it turns into brilliant sufficient exterior, all the inner lights are turned off.
“We like to joke that if you are cold, you aren’t moving fast enough,” Ms Mistry stated.
“And it’s better than our old place – this one has a toilet, and it doesn’t have holes in the ceiling.”
She stated she tries not to consider what her upcoming power invoice for the place will seem like.
Ultimately, she would slightly the charity did not exist in any respect: “But we do, and we need help to keep going.”
